Get in Touch** The Acura repair market serving Conestee, SC, is robust and competitive, centered in the adjacent city of Greenville. Residents have access to a healthy mix of a factory-authorized dealership and several highly competent independent specialists. **Leith Acura** stands as the unequivocal leader for warranty work, advanced proprietary system repairs (like SH-AWD and hybrid systems), and recalls, leveraging direct manufacturer support. The independent shops, such as **Import Motor Service** and **Japanese Auto Repair**, compete effectively by offering deep brand-specific expertise, often more personalized customer service, and typically lower labor rates, making them ideal for out-of-warranty vehicles, performance projects, and routine maintenance. Pricing is tiered, with the dealership commanding a premium for its OEM parts and factory-certified technicians. The independent specialists offer significant value, with labor rates generally 15-30% lower. The overall quality of service available is high, and Acura owners in the Conestee area have excellent options for both dealer-level precision and independent specialist care.

Common questions about acura repair services in Conestee, SC
In the Conestee and greater Greenville area, common Acura issues include premature brake wear from stop-and-go traffic on Woodruff Road and I-85, along with air conditioning system strain due to our humid summers. We also frequently service transmission and VCM (Variable Cylinder Management) system concerns on popular models like the MDX and TL.
Look for shops in the Conestee/Greenville area that are members of the Automotive Service Association (ASA) and employ ASE-certified technicians, specifically with experience in Honda/Acura vehicles. Checking for strong online reviews and asking if they use OEM or OEM-equivalent parts is also crucial for quality repairs.
Typically, yes. The Acura dealership in Greenville generally has higher labor rates and uses OEM parts exclusively. A reputable independent shop in the Conestee area can provide significant savings, often using the same quality parts and technician expertise for routine maintenance and most repairs.
Seek immediate service for the check engine light, especially before South Carolina emissions testing, and for the brake system light given our hilly terrain. The maintenance minder system (codes like A1, B12) should be followed promptly, as delayed service can worsen issues exacerbated by local heat and traffic conditions.
Conestee's proximity to I-85 and frequent short-trip driving necessitates more frequent oil changes and brake inspections. Furthermore, the high pollen count and humidity require diligent cabin air filter changes and earlier attention to A/C performance to maintain system health and interior air quality.
